[Detailed Description of the Invention] (a) Field of the Invention The present invention relates to an air conditioner incorporating a centrifugal fan.

(b) Prior art A package type air conditioner has a heat exchanger and a centrifugal fan arranged in a vertical relationship, and the inside of the air conditioner is divided by a partition plate, and the centrifugal fan is installed in a square hole in the center of the partition plate. The discharge part of the casing was inserted and connected.

(c) Problems with the conventional technology In order to suspend the centrifugal fan casing from the partition plate, the partition plate is made of a large strength member with a square hole in the center, and the centrifugal fan casing is suspended in the partition plate. Since a sufficient clearance is required to insert the discharge part of the casing, discharged air tends to leak from this clearance to the suction side of the fan casing.
Moreover, it has the disadvantage that wind noise is likely to be generated at the joint between the square hole and the discharge portion.

(d) Purpose of the Invention The present invention provides a thin and lightweight air conditioner in which the suction side and the discharge side of a centrifugal fan casing are separated by an extension of the scroll portion of the fan casing to eliminate air leakage and wind noise. (E) Summary of the Invention The present invention extends the scroll portion of a centrifugal fan casing, and connects the edges of the extended portion to at least two adjacent inner walls of the outer box to connect the suction side and the discharge side of the fan casing. The structure is divided into sections.

(G) Effects of the Invention According to the present invention, the suction side and the discharge side of the fan casing can be reliably connected by a simple structure in which the scroll portion is extended and its edges are joined to at least two adjacent inner walls of the outer box. It can be partitioned.

Furthermore, by forming the scroll portion and the extension portion from a single sheet metal strip, manufacturing is facilitated, and air leakage and wind noise can be reliably eliminated.

Furthermore, by opening the back side of the centrifugal fan casing that faces the suction surface and closing it with the back plate of the outer box, the number of parts for the fan casing can be reduced, and it can be combined with the single sheet metal shape of the scroll part and extension part. It can be manufactured with a total of two parts, including the suction surface part, which is a separate member.
